rough-cut board; construction lumber
Refers to a board that has been sawn but not planed or finished, used in construction.
Rough-cut boards were stacked at the site.
batten; tie beam
In carpentry, a horizontal structural member used to tie rafters or studs together.
Nail the batten to the beam.
Compound of 貫 (ぬき, 'horizontal tie') and 板 (いた, 'board'). The exact historical derivation is uncertain, but the term is conventionally associated with its construction uses.
